FAQs - booking Scranton flights

  • Does Scranton Airport provide facilities that cater to the needs of disabled travelers?

    Travelers with disabilities can easily navigate Scranton Airport due to amenities like elevators, ramps and curbs. Visually impaired passengers can also find their way around all levels of the airport due to the braille signs. The baggage claim area, restrooms and ticketing counters are also wheelchair accessible. Travelers requiring wheelchair assistance or an escort to the aircraft can put in a request through the airline.

  • Does Scranton Airport have work areas for business travelers?

    Business travelers can conduct business meetings at the business center located pre-security in the Joseph M. McDade Terminal. The business center comes fully equipped with essentials like workstations, a fax machine, a photocopy machine, high-speed internet and a computer kiosk. Alternatively, travelers can rent out the conference room.

  • Is there accommodation on Scranton Airport’s grounds?

    The cozy Best Western Plus Wilkes Barre-Scranton Airport Hotel, situated approximately 1 mile away from the terminal, offers top-notch amenities and affordable accommodation for travelers who wish to stay within Scranton Airport. This homey airport hotel also offers hotel guests a free ride to and from the terminal onboard the airport shuttles.

  • Can I park my vehicle at Scranton Airport?

    There are multiple parking lots with ample parking space at Scranton Airport. Lot D offers parking near the terminal for around $14 a day, while garage parking is available for around $14 for 24h. This way, your car will stay safe.

  • How far is Wilkes-Barre Scranton Airport from central Scranton?

    The distance between Wilkes-Barre Scranton Airport and downtown Scranton is 6 miles.

  • What is the name of Scranton’s airport?

    Scranton is served by Wilkes-Barre Scranton Airport, also commonly referred to as Wilkes-Barre Scranton or Wilkes-Barre/Scranton Intl. The airport code is AVP.

  • Travelers looking to save on transport costs should take the route 17 bus from Scranton Airport (AVP) to downtown Scranton. The bus trip takes approximately 42min. Alternatively, you can hop on board one of the metered taxis, which stop outside the ground transportation area.
  • Active members of the United States military flying through Scranton airport can wait for their flights in the comfort of the military appreciation lounge located on the first-floor airside.
  • Scranton Airport serves Back Mountain, located approximately 14 miles away; Dunmore, located approximately 7.7 miles away; Hazleton city, situated approximately 20 miles away; and Kingston, located approximately 10.45 miles away from the airport.
  • Those traveling with kids can keep them occupied at the Destination Arcade as they wait for their flights. The arcade, located on the terminal’s second floor, has multiple fun coin-operated arcade games and a change machine.
  • If you need a quiet place away from the noisy terminal to meditate or pray, head over to the meditation room on the second floor. Whatever your faith, you are free to use the room at your convenience since it is open 24h a day.
  • If you feel overwhelmed by travel stress, you can get rid of the tension at the massage chairs located on the second floor of the terminal building. The service charge is $1 for a maximum of 3min and $5 for around 15min.
  • Northeast PA News & Gift shop, located on the second floor right next to Lucky’s Restaurant & Bar, has everything you may need. Head over to this gift shop if you need to grab some last-minute travel essentials like interesting reading materials or toys to keep the kids occupied during the flight.
  • If you need to send mail last minute to your loved ones before departing from Scranton Airport, you can use the FedEx mailing center or the USPS mailing center, which you will find near the baggage claim area.
